Mark Twain (Samuel L. Clemens) received Patent No. 121,992 for "An Improvement in Adjustable and Detachable Straps for Garments." He later received two more patents: one for a self-pasting scrapbook and one for a game to help players remember important historical dates.
Make the Most of PatentStorm
See this month's Top Inventors and Most Cited Patents.
Stay on top of the latest patents by subscribing to an RSS feed.
Got questions? Ask a Patent Expert!
Registered users: Manage your profile, comments and alerts.
AbstractTwo data storage systems are interconnected by a data link for remote mirroring of data. Each volume of data is configured as local, primary in a remotely mirrored volume pair, or secondary in a remotely mirrored volume pair. Normally, a host computer directly accesses either a local or a primary volume, and data written to a primary volume is automatically sent over the link to a corresponding secondary volume. Each remotely mirrored volume pair can operate in a selected synchronization mode including synchronous, semi-synchronous, adaptive copy--remote write pending, and adaptive copy--disk. A number of automatic and non-automatic recovery mechanisms are provided on a logical volume basis for a desired level of data integrity and degree of operator or application program involvement. If a "volume domino" mode is enabled for a remotely mirrored volume pair, access to a volume of the pair is denied when the other volume is inaccessible. In a "links domino" mode, access to all remotely mirrored volumes is denied when remote mirroring is disrupted by an all-links failure. The domino modes can be used to initiate application-based recovery, for example, recovering a secondary data file using a secondary log file. In an overwrite cache mode, remote write-pending data in cache can be overwritten. In a "log-in-cache" mode, multiple versions of write data can be stored in cache in order to recover from a "rolling disaster".Other References
| InventorAssigneeApplicationNo. 819672 filed on 03/17/1997US Classes:711/162, Backup710/1, INPUT/OUTPUT DATA PROCESSING711/161, Archiving714/5, Of memory or peripheral subsystem714/6, Redundant stored data accessed (e.g., duplicated data, error correction coded data, or other parity-type data)714/718, Memory testing714/763Memory accessField of Search711/162, Backup711/144, Cache status data bit711/145, Access control bit711/161, Archiving707/6, Pattern matching access707/7, Sorting710/1, INPUT/OUTPUT DATA PROCESSING714/5, Of memory or peripheral subsystem714/6, Redundant stored data accessed (e.g., duplicated data, error correction coded data, or other parity-type data)714/718, Memory testing714/763Memory accessExaminersPrimary: Thai, Tuan V.Attorney, Agent or FirmUS Patent References3588839, 3835260, 3866182, 4020466, Memory hierarchy system with journaling and copy backIssued on: 04/26/1977 Inventor: Cordi , et al.4057849, Text editing and display system Issued on: 11/08/1977 Inventor: Ying , et al.4084231, System for facilitating the copying back of data in disc and tape units of a memory hierarchial system Issued on: 04/11/1978 Inventor: Capozzi, et al.4094000, Graphics display unit Issued on: 06/06/1978 Inventor: Brudevold4124843, Multi-lingual input keyboard and display Issued on: 11/07/1978 Inventor: Bramson , et al.4150429, Text editing and display system having a multiplexer circuit interconnecting plural visual displays Issued on: 04/17/1979 Inventor: Ying4161777, Visual output means for a data processing system Issued on: 07/17/1979 Inventor: Ying4204251, Interconnection unit for multiple data processing systems Issued on: 05/20/1980 Inventor: Brudevold4342079, Duplicated memory system having status indication Issued on: 07/27/1982 Inventor: Stewart , et al.4396984, Peripheral systems employing multipathing, path and access grouping Issued on: 08/02/1983 Inventor: Videki, II4430727, Storage element reconfiguration Issued on: 02/07/1984 Inventor: Moore , et al.4453215, Central processing apparatus for fault-tolerant computing Issued on: 06/05/1984 Inventor: Reid4464713, Method and apparatus for converting addresses of a backing store having addressable data storage devices for accessing a cache attached to the backing store Issued on: 08/07/1984 Inventor: Benhase , et al.4577272, Fault tolerant and load sharing processing system Issued on: 03/18/1986 Inventor: Ballew , et al.4608688, Processing system tolerant of loss of access to secondary storage Issued on: 08/26/1986 Inventor: Hansen , et al.4634100, Fence wire tightener Issued on: 01/06/1987 Inventor: Glen4698808, Method for detecting intermittent error in volatile memory Issued on: 10/06/1987 Inventor: Ishii4710870, Central computer backup system utilizing localized data bases Issued on: 12/01/1987 Inventor: Blackwell , et al.4755928, Outboard back-up and recovery system with transfer of randomly accessible data sets between cache and host and cache and tape simultaneously Issued on: 07/05/1988 Inventor: Johnson , et al.4769764, Modular computer system with portable travel unit Issued on: 09/06/1988 Inventor: Levanon4779189, Peripheral subsystem initialization method and apparatus Issued on: 10/18/1988 Inventor: Legvold , et al.4783834, System for creating transposed image data from a run end or run length representation of an image Issued on: 11/08/1988 Inventor: Anderson , et al.4785472, Remote teaching system Issued on: 11/15/1988 Inventor: Shapiro4797750, Method and apparatus for transmitting/recording computer-generated displays on an information channel having only audio bandwidth Issued on: 01/10/1989 Inventor: Karweit4805106, Method of and arrangement for ordering of multiprocessor operations in a multiprocessor system with redundant resources Issued on: 02/14/1989 Inventor: Pfeifer4814592, Apparatus and method for storing and retrieving articles Issued on: 03/21/1989 Inventor: Bradt , et al.4837680, Controlling asynchronously operating peripherals Issued on: 06/06/1989 Inventor: Crockett , et al.4841475, Data transfer system and method for channels with serial transfer line Issued on: 06/20/1989 Inventor: Ishizuka4849978, Memory unit backup using checksum Issued on: 07/18/1989 Inventor: Dishon , et al.4862411, Multiple copy data mechanism on synchronous disk drives Issued on: 08/29/1989 Inventor: Dishon , et al.4888686, System for storing information with comparison of stored data values Issued on: 12/19/1989 Inventor: Sinz, et al.4916605, Fast write operations Issued on: 04/10/1990 Inventor: Beardsley, et al.4949187, Video communications system having a remotely controlled central source of video and audio data Issued on: 08/14/1990 Inventor: Cohen4985695, Computer security device Issued on: 01/15/1991 Inventor: Wilkinson, et al.5007053, Method and apparatus for checksum address generation in a fail-safe modular memory Issued on: 04/09/1991 Inventor: Iyer, et al.5029199, Distributed control and storage for a large capacity messaging system Issued on: 07/02/1991 Inventor: Jones, et al.5051887, Maintaining duplex-paired storage devices during gap processing using of a dual copy function Issued on: 09/24/1991 Inventor: Berger, et al.5060142, System which matches a received sequence of channel commands to sequence defining rules for predictively optimizing peripheral subsystem operations Issued on: 10/22/1991 Inventor: Menon, et al.5060185, File backup system Issued on: 10/22/1991 Inventor: Naito, ;, , , --> Naito, et al.5089958, Fault tolerant computer backup system Issued on: 02/18/1992 Inventor: Horton, et al.5097439, Expansible fixed disk drive subsystem for computer Issued on: 03/17/1992 Inventor: Patriquin, et al.5099485, Fault tolerant computer systems with fault isolation and repair Issued on: 03/24/1992 Inventor: Bruckert, et al.5123099, Hot standby memory copy system Issued on: 06/16/1992 Inventor: Shibata, et al.5127048, Free standing data transfer device for coupling a facsimile machine to a telephone line Issued on: 06/30/1992 Inventor: Press, et al.5132787, Digital color copying machine with color separation Issued on: 07/21/1992 Inventor: Omi, et al.5134711, Computer with intelligent memory system Issued on: 07/28/1992 Inventor: Asthana, et al.5146576, Managing high speed slow access channel to slow speed cyclic system data transfer Issued on: 09/08/1992 Inventor: Beardsley, et al.5146605, Direct control facility for multiprocessor network Issued on: 09/08/1992 Inventor: Beukema, et al.5155814, Nonsynchronous channel/DASD communication system Issued on: 10/13/1992 Inventor: Beardsley, et al.5155835, Multilevel, hierarchical, dynamically mapped data storage subsystem Issued on: 10/13/1992 Inventor: Belsan5155845, Data storage system for providing redundant copies of data on different disk drives Issued on: 10/13/1992 Inventor: Beal, et al.5157770, Nonsynchronous DASD control Issued on: 10/20/1992 Inventor: Beardsley, et al.5159671, Data transfer unit for small computer system with simultaneous transfer to two memories and error detection and rewrite to substitute address Issued on: 10/27/1992 Inventor: Iwami5170471, Command delivery for a computing system for transferring data between a host and subsystems with busy and reset indication Issued on: 12/08/1992 Inventor: Bonevento, et al.5175837, Synchronizing and processing of memory access operations in multiprocessor systems using a directory of lock bits Issued on: 12/29/1992 Inventor: Arnold, et al.5175839, Storage control system in a computer system for double-writing Issued on: 12/29/1992 Inventor: Ikeda, et al.5185864, Interrupt handling for a computing system with logical devices and interrupt reset Issued on: 02/09/1993 Inventor: Bonevento, et al.5201053, Dynamic polling of devices for nonsynchronous channel connection Issued on: 04/06/1993 Inventor: Benhase, et al.5202887, Access control method for shared duplex direct access storage device and computer system therefor Issued on: 04/13/1993 Inventor: Ueno, et al.5206939, System and method for disk mapping and data retrieval Issued on: 04/27/1993 Inventor: Yanai, et al.5210865, Transferring data between storage media while maintaining host processor access for I/O operations Issued on: 05/11/1993 Inventor: Davis, et al.5235690, Method for operating a cached peripheral data storage subsystem including a step of subsetting the data transfer into subsets of data records Issued on: 08/10/1993 Inventor: Beardsley, et al.5235692, Disk rotational position controls for channel operations in a cached peripheral subsystem Issued on: 08/10/1993 Inventor: Ayres, et al.5239659, Phantom duplex copy group apparatus for a disk drive array data storge subsystem Issued on: 08/24/1993 Inventor: Rudeseal, et al.5263154, Method and system for incremental time zero backup copying of data Issued on: 11/16/1993 Inventor: Eastridge, et al.5269011, Dynamically reconfigurable data storage system with storage system controllers selectively operable as channel adapters on storage device adapters Issued on: 12/07/1993 Inventor: Yanai, et al.5274645, Disk array system Issued on: 12/28/1993 Inventor: Idleman, et al.5276867, Digital data storage system with improved data migration Issued on: 01/04/1994 Inventor: Kenley, et al.5285451, Failure-tolerant mass storage system Issued on: 02/08/1994 Inventor: Henson, et al.5313664, Point of sale system having backup file device Issued on: 05/17/1994 Inventor: Sugiyama, et al.5335352, Reconfigurable, multi-function data storage system controller selectively operable as an input channel adapter and a data storage unit adapter Issued on: 08/02/1994 Inventor: Yanai, et al.5343477, Data processing system with data transmission failure recovery measures Issued on: 08/30/1994 Inventor: Yamada5375232, Method and system for asynchronous pre-staging of backup copies in a data processing storage subsystem Issued on: 12/20/1994 Inventor: Legvold, et al.5377342, Method of controlling a duplex data storage system and data processing system using the same Issued on: 12/27/1994 Inventor: Sakai, et al.5379412, Method and system for dynamic allocation of buffer storage space during backup copying Issued on: 01/03/1995 Inventor: Eastridge, et al.5381539, System and method for dynamically controlling cache management Issued on: 01/10/1995 Inventor: Yanai, et al.5428796, System and method for regulating access to direct access storage devices in data processing systems Issued on: 06/27/1995 Inventor: Iskiyan, et al.5446872, Method for error recovery in a non-synchronous control unit Issued on: 08/29/1995 Inventor: Ayres, et al.5459857, Fault tolerant disk array data storage subsystem Issued on: 10/17/1995 Inventor: Ludlam, et al.5463752, Method and system for enhancing the efficiency of communication between multiple direct access storage devices and a storage system controller Issued on: 10/31/1995 Inventor: Benhase, et al.5526484, Method and system for pipelining the processing of channel command words Issued on: 06/11/1996 Inventor: Casper, et al.5537533, System and method for remote mirroring of digital data from a primary network server to a remote network server Issued on: 07/16/1996 Inventor: Staheli, et al.5544345, Coherence controls for store-multiple shared data coordinated by cache directory entries in a shared electronic storage Issued on: 08/06/1996 Inventor: Carpenter, et al.5544347, Data storage system controlled remote data mirroring with respectively maintained data indices Issued on: 08/06/1996 Inventor: Yanai, et al.5555371, Data backup copying with delayed directory updating and reduced numbers of DASD accesses at a back up site using a log structured array data storage Issued on: 09/10/1996 Inventor: Duyanovich, et al.5574950, Remote data shadowing using a multimode interface to dynamically reconfigure control link-level and communication link-level Issued on: 11/12/1996 Inventor: Hathorn, et al.5584039, System for coordinating execution of multiple concurrent channel programs without host processor involvement using suspend and resume commands to control data transfer between I/O devices Issued on: 12/10/1996 Inventor: Johnson, et al.5592618, Remote copy secondary data copy validation-audit function Issued on: 01/07/1997 Inventor: Micka, et al.5606359, Video on demand system with multiple data sources configured to provide vcr-like services Issued on: 02/25/1997 Inventor: Youden, et al.5608865, Stand-in Computer file server providing fast recovery from computer file server failures Issued on: 03/04/1997 Inventor: Midgely, et al.5611069, Disk array apparatus which predicts errors using mirror disks that can be accessed in parallel Issued on: 03/11/1997 Inventor: Matoba5613155, Bundling client write requests in a server Issued on: 03/18/1997 Inventor: Baldiga, et al.5615329, Remote data duplexing Issued on: 03/25/1997 Inventor: Kern, et al.5649093, Server disk error recovery system Issued on: 07/15/1997 Inventor: Hanko, et al.5673382, Automated management of off-site storage volumes for disaster recovery Issued on: 09/30/1997 Inventor: Cannon, et al.5680580, Remote copy system for setting request interconnect bit in each adapter within storage controller and initiating request connect frame in response to the setting bit Issued on: 10/21/1997 Inventor: Beardsley, et al.5680640, System for migrating data by selecting a first or second transfer means based on the status of a data element map initialized to a predetermined state Issued on: 10/21/1997 Inventor: Ofek, et al.5682396, Control unit in storage subsystem with improvement of redundant data updating Issued on: 10/28/1997 Inventor: Yamamoto, et al.5682513, Cache queue entry linking for DASD record updates Issued on: 10/28/1997 Inventor: Candelaria, et al.5721916, Method and system for shadowing file system structures from multiple types of networks Issued on: 02/24/1998 Inventor: Pardikar5724500, Multiple writing volume backup method Issued on: 03/03/1998 Inventor: Shinmura, et al.5742792, Remote data mirroring Issued on: 04/21/1998 Inventor: Yanai, et al.5774668, System for on-line service in which gateway computer uses service map which includes loading condition of servers broadcasted by application servers for load balancing Issued on: 06/30/1998 Inventor: Choquier, et al.5809543, Fault tolerant extended processing complex for redundant nonvolatile file caching Issued on: 09/15/1998 Inventor: Byers, et al.5815146, Video on demand system with multiple data sources configured to provide VCR-like services Issued on: 09/29/1998 Inventor: Youden, et al.5829047, Backup memory for reliable operation Issued on: 10/27/1998 Inventor: Jacks, et al.5889935, Disaster control features for remote data mirroring Issued on: 03/30/1999 Inventor: Ofek, et al.5901327Bundling of write data from channel commands in a command chain for transmission over a data link between data storage systems for remote data mirroring Issued on: 05/04/1999 Inventor: Ofek Foreign Patent References
International ClassG06F 012/16 |